I joined Northumbria University in September 2013 after serving at Curtin University in Malaysia as a Senior Lecturer and a Head of Mechanical Engineering department. I also worked as a postdoctoral research fellow at the University of Leeds in the UK, Okayama University in Japan, and Chonnam National University in South Korea. In addition, I have spent 5 years of my career working for automotive industry as an engineer and manager. During my academic career I have obtained a few awards and fellowships such as Global scholarship for PhD studies, Japan Society for the Promotion of Science postdoctoral research fellowship, and the Postdoctoral research fellowship under the award of Technology Strategy Board. I was also awarded the Felix Weinberg Prize for best research paper presentation at the Forum for Research Students and Early Career Researchers organized by the Institute of Physics.
